如何在“在环境中找到”字段上添加预定义的值

时间:2019-11-13 13:18:29

标签: azure-devops

AzureDevOps具有一个称为“在环境中找到”的文件。

我想将此添加到我的工作项中,但是我想设置一个用户应选择的预定义值列表。

我可以通过添加新的自定义文件来做到这一点,但是为AzureDevOps已经拥有的文件添加自定义文件会很奇怪。

问题:是否可以为已存在的字段配置一组预定义的值?

AzureDevOps Found In Environment

1 个答案:

答案 0 :(得分:0)

实际上,Azure DevOps仅支持用户自定义任何系统选择列表(原因字段除外)的值,例如严重性,活动,优先级等。您可以参考here来获取有关自定义系统的信息选择列表值。

作为我的测试,“在环境中找到”字段仅支持一个默认值,不支持选择列表项。 enter image description here

因此,根据您的问题,某些字段可以为已存在的字段配置一组值,但不能为“在环境中找到”字段配置值。

或者您可以使用XML根据您的规则自定义自己的过程和字段值。下面是一个有关如何在XML中定义工作项选择列表项的简单示例。

此外,只有从tfs迁移到天蓝色的devops之后,您才可以编辑xml选项。关于XML,您可以参考here

<FIELD name="Priority" refname="Microsoft.VSTS.Common.Priority" type="Integer" reportable="dimension">
    <HELPTEXT>Business importance. 1=must fix; 4=unimportant.</HELPTEXT>
    <ALLOWEDVALUES expanditems="true">
      <LISTITEM value="1" />
      <LISTITEM value="2" />
      <LISTITEM value="3" />
      <LISTITEM value="4" />
    </ALLOWEDVALUES>
    <DEFAULT from="value" value="2" />
  </FIELD>